# yum - 命令参数详解

Yum(全称为 Yellow dog Updater, Modified)是一个在 Fedora 和 RedHat 以及 CentOS 中的 Shell 前端软件包管理器。基于 RPM 包管理,能够从指定的服务器自动下载 RPM 包并且安装,可以自动处理依赖性关系,并且一次安装所有依赖的软件包,无须繁琐地一次次下载、安装。

# yum 常用命令

YUM 命令格式为:

YUM [command] [package] -y|-q

其中的 [options] 是可选。-y 安装或者卸载出现 YES 时,自动确认 yes;-q 不显示安装的过程。

  • yum install httpd 安装 httpd 软件包;
  • yum search YUM 搜索软件包;
  • yum list httpd 显示指定程序包安装情况 httpd;
  • yum list 显示所有已安装及可安装的软件包;
  • yum remove httpd 删除程序包 httpd;
  • yum erase httpd 删除程序包 httpd;
  • yum update tree 内核升级或者软件更新;
  • yum update httpd 更新 httpd 软件;
  • yum check-update 检查可更新的程序;
  • yum info httpd 显示安装包信息 httpd;
  • yum provides */rz 列出 rz 命令由哪个软件包提供;
  • yum grouplist 查询可以用 groupinstall 安装的组名称;
  • yum groupinstall “Chinese Support” 安装中文支持;
  • yum groupremove “Chinese Support” 删除程序组 Chinese Support;
  • yum deplist httpd 查看程序 httpd 依赖情况;
  • yum clean packages 清除缓存目录下的软件包;
  • yum clean headers 清除缓存目录下的 headers;
  • yum clean all 清除缓存目录下的软件包及旧的 headers。
上次更新: 8/3/2021, 10:02:17 AM